Department of Parks And Recreation Expands Swimming Pool Hours

February 1, 2021 at 11:00 am tdemartini
  • Blogs
  • Tweet
  • Share
  • Reddit
  • +1
  • Pocket
  • LinkedIn

Beginning February 2021, The Hawaiʻi County Department of Parks and Recreation is expanding island-wide swimming pool operations.

The following schedules take effect on February 1, except for the Kohala Swimming Pool, which will be effective February 8. A press release from the Department of Parks and Recreation states each pool will continue to offer 45- minute swim sessions for lap swimming only, on a first-come, first-served basis during the following time slots.

Kawamoto Pool – Monday thru Friday 9:00 a.m., 10:00 a.m., 11:00 a.m., 1:00 p.m., 2:00 p.m., 3:00 p.m.

KCAC – Mondays, Wednesdays, and Fridays 8:00 a.m., 9:00 a.m., 10:00 a.m., 11:00 a.m., 1:00 p.m. Thursdays – 8:00 a.m., 9:00 a.m., 10:00 a.m., 11:00 a.m., 1:00 p.m., 2:00 p.m., 3:00 p.m.

Pāhoa Pool – Sunday thru Thursday 9:00 a.m., 10:00 a.m., 11:00 a.m., 1:00 p.m., 2:00 p.m., 3:00 p.m.

Konawaena Pool – Mondays, Wednesdays, and Fridays 9:00 a.m., 10:00 a.m., 11:00 a.m., 1:00 p.m., 2:00 p.m., 3:00 p.m.

Pāhala Pool – Mondays, Wednesdays, and Fridays 9:00 a.m., 10:00 a.m., 11:00 a.m., 1:00 p.m., 2:00 p.m., 3:00 p.m. Tuesdays and Thursdays 10:00 a.m., 11:00 a.m., 1:00 p.m., 2:00 p.m., 3:00 p.m.

Kohala Pool – Monday thru Thursday 9:00 a.m., 10:00 a.m., 11:00 a.m., 1:00 p.m., 2:00 p.m., 3:00 p.m.
